SUGAR BEACH OCEANFRONT CONDOMINIUM GUIDE
Sugar Beach is one of the longest continuous beaches in the State of Hawaii and most likely the longest in Maui. It is about 3 miles long (will vary depending where you measure from). It goes from North Kihei (across from the old Maui Lu (which was torn down and now is the Hilton Timeshare) to Maalaea. It is great beach to walk, or jog. Good beach to ocean activites but not the best for surfing as waves are not consistent unless we have a swell coming through. If the swell hits right then one of the fastest waves can be had in Maalaea and that surf break is called Freight Trains. Here is a video of Freight Trains from about a year ago on a massive swell!
Sugar Beach Condominiums:
There are 7 condominium complexes. Kihei Beach, Maalaea Surf, Kihei Kai, Nani Kai Hale, Kihei Sands, Sugar Beach Resort and Kealia. All of these are fee simple complexes except for Kealia. Although there may be a leasehold unit I am not aware of any at this point but do double check with your realtor.
Why are there only 7 condominium complexes on a beach more than 3 miles long? Well, alot of the beach is backed by Kealia National Wildlife Refuge. There is boardwalk there and it is lovely place to watch the native Hawaiian Stilt birds and migrating birds as well. https://www.fws.gov/refuge/kealia-pond
Kihei Beach:
Nearest Beach: On Sugar Beach
Short-Term Rentable: Yes
Number of units: 53 Units, One Building.
Land: 1.3 Acres
Year Built: 1973
Notable: All units face the ocean. Elevator Building. Near Outrigger Canoe Club. Across the street from a convenience store and bakery and a little farmers market stand.

Maalaea Surf (contrary to its name it is not located in Maalaea)
Nearest Beach: On Sugar Beach
Short-Term Rentable: yes
Number of units: 59 Units, 8 Buildings
Land: 5.17 Acres
Year Built:1973
Notable: Good green space. Some of the upstairs units have lofts and vaulted ceilings. Tennis Court. Pools.

Nani Kai Hale
Nearest Beach: On Sugar Beach
Short-Term Rentable: Yes
Number of units: 46 Units. One Building ,6 floors
Land: 0.91 Acres
Year Built: 1974
Notable: The is just one stack of units that face directly on Ocean. The rest are towards the side as the building is narrow. Although some of the units still have stellar ocean views. Pool on ocean side. Elevator Building.

Sugar Beach Resort
Nearest Beach: On Sugar Beach
Short-Term Rentable: Yes
Number of units: 215 Units, 2 Buildings, 6 Floors
Land: 4.21 Acres
Year Built: 1977
Notable: The largest condominium complex on Sugar Beach. Good green space. Pool. Elevator Buildings. As of this post the complex area has a sandwich shop, massage spa.
